Israel Defense Forces says Bipin was murdered in captivity during first months of Gaza war
Final conclusions will be determined after the completion of the examination of circumstances of death, the IDF says.
Post Report
The Israel Defense Forces has said Nepali youth Bipin Joshi was murdered in captivity during the first months of the Gaza war that began in October 2023.
“Bipin was abducted at the age of 23 from a shelter in Kibbutz Alumim by Hamas. It is assessed that he was murdered in captivity during the first months of the war,” the IDF, the national military of Israel, said in a statement posted on X on Tuesday. “Final conclusions will be determined after the completion of the examination of the circumstances of death by the National Center of Forensic Medicine.”
IDF representatives informed the families of Guy Iluz, Bipin Joshi, and two additional deceased hostages, whose names have not yet been cleared for publication by their families, that their loved ones have been brought back for burial, the IDF said.
Citing the information and intelligence it received, the IDF said Guy was abducted alive and injured by Hamas after escaping the Nova music festival. “Guy died from his wounds after not receiving proper medical treatment while held captive,” it claimed. “He was 26 years old at his death.”
A student under Israel’s Learn and Earn Programme, Joshi was working at the Alumim kibbutz with 16 other Nepalis when Hamas launched its assault in October 2023. Ten Nepalis were killed, five were injured, and one escaped unharmed in the attack.
Joshi’s whereabouts were unknown since then.
His name was missing from the list of 20 living hostages freed earlier under a US-brokered ceasefire deal. His death was confirmed by Israeli officials, who briefed Ambassador Pandit and Joshi’s family in a virtual meeting on Monday.
Successive governments had pursued all possible diplomatic channels to secure Joshi’s release, engaging with officials from Qatar, Jordan, Egypt, and the US.
Joshi’s family, who had travelled to Israel and the US seeking his release, are now awaiting the return of his body to Nepal.
